Doodlebops Background Information

The Doodlebops presents a blend of dancing, singing, rhyming and even a few jokes. The entertainers are a colorful lot with an abundance of face paint and colorful wigs. There shows are diffinitely the hottest thing to reach the very young children. Much as the Wiggle has done in the past the Doodlebops have wont th hearts of preschool children everywhere.

Although they are a colorful bunch of entertainers, they can in fact entertain. Their make beautiful music that has a straightforward lecture attached but the preschooler doesn’t know this. Most of the tunes they play and sing are catchy tune and during the shows many of the children in the audience can be heard singing along with them. The Doodlebops are made up of three very talented musicians and entertainers.

DeeDee Doodle is really a young 23 year old named Lisa Lennox. DeeDee is usually dressed in purple and pink from her head to her toe and possess a very beautiful voice. DeeDee also is very proficient on the piano as well as doiung magic tricks. Lisa has been performing from the age of three. Prior to becoming involved with the Doodlebops she has done a small amount of performing for the Gemini Awards as well as her small role in the prologue of the TV series entitled Road to Avonlea. Lisa’s training is in the field of music and professional dance. Because of her vast love of the performing arts she attended the “Etobicoke School of the Arts” or commonly known as ESA, instead of the traditional type of high school.

When the Doodlebops first started out Canada, The crew including Lisa, Jonathan and Chad and the three spent seven months creating twenty six TV episodes. Lisa states that she loves to make children happy and enjoys being a part of a rock and roll group especially for preschoolers.

Moe Doodle is really Jonathan Wexler. He dresses predominate in orange and red colors while on the stage. He specializes in drum playing but also enjoys many of the children’s games that he duplicates on stage. Jonathan was born in London Ontario and was a member of the Kids Theatre Company.

Chad McNamara performs in the role as Rooney Doodle who is blue in color while on the stage. His chosen musical instrument is the guitar. Chad's professional credits include the Will Rogers follies where he played a western wrangler. The follies were shown for a period of two weeks in Ottowa Theaters during the months of November and December of 1995. In 2003 he also performed minor parts as a cast member in the “Mamma Mia” tour of Canada in 2003.
